About us

Seccl is the Octopus‑owned embedded investment platform that’s on a mission to help more people invest – and invest well. We’re B‑Corp certified, have an impressive product‑market fit, early traction, and the potential to transform an outdated industry for the better. We’re proud to be part of Octopus, the multi‑billion‑pound group that revitalises broken industries through companies like Octopus Energy, Octopus Investments and Octopus Money.


The role

We’re looking for a Group Product Manager to lead the Accounts tribe, a critical part of the Seccl platform, which sits at the heart of how investors and advisers interact with Seccl – from tax‑efficient wrappers to pensions, investment strategies and account‑level functionality.

Your tribe will include:

* Investment wrappers such as JISA, ISA and GIA, ensuring smooth, compliant experiences across firms and end investors
* SIPP capability and the infrastructure needed to support a range of pension use cases
* Enabling advisers and investors to access the right assets aligned to risk profiles
* Account‑level functionality such as fees and inter‑account movements

You won’t lead a single squad day‑to‑day. Instead, you’ll lead multiple Product Managers across several squads, setting direction, aligning priorities, and driving strategic initiatives across your domain. You’ll work closely with two other Group Product Managers (Custody and Experience) to shape the end‑to‑end platform roadmap.
